Smithsonian magazine has launched a podcast, titled, “There’s More to That.”
The new podcast will feature the magazine’s journalists,
working to report on major issues.
New free episodes will be released every other Thursday on the magazine’s website and on other major podcast platforms, including Apple
Podcasts, Amazon Music, Spotify, Overcast and Pocket Casts.
Current episodes cover the backstories of the movies movies Oppenheimer and Barbie. In another, Minesh
Bacrania, a physicist-turned-photographer, discusses his experience photographing inside the top-secret labs at Los Alamos National Laboratory, where J. Robert Oppenheimer and other scientists created
the first nuclear weapon.
There’s More to That is hosted by Smithsonian magazine’s Chris Klimek.
